package org.apache.jena.sparql.engine.iterator;
import java.util.Iterator ;
import org.apache.jena.atlas.io.IndentedWriter ;
import org.apache.jena.atlas.lib.Lib ;
import org.apache.jena.atlas.logging.Log ;
import org.apache.jena.sparql.engine.ExecutionContext ;
import org.apache.jena.sparql.engine.QueryIterator ;
import org.apache.jena.sparql.serializer.SerializationContext ;
/** Query iterator that checks everything was closed correctly */
public class QueryIteratorCheck extends QueryIteratorWrapper
{
private ExecutionContext execCxt ;
private QueryIteratorCheck(QueryIterator qIter, ExecutionContext execCxt)
{
super(qIter) ;
if ( qIter instanceof QueryIteratorCheck )
Log.warn(this, "Checking checked iterator") ;
this.execCxt = execCxt ;
}
@Override
public void close()
{
super.close() ;
checkForOpenIterators(execCxt) ;
}
// Be silent about ourselves.
@Override
public void output(IndentedWriter out, SerializationContext sCxt)
{ iterator.output(out, sCxt) ; }
public static void checkForOpenIterators(ExecutionContext execContext)
{ dump(execContext, false); }
public static QueryIteratorCheck check(QueryIterator qIter, ExecutionContext execCxt)
{
if ( qIter instanceof QueryIteratorCheck )
return (QueryIteratorCheck)qIter ;
return new QueryIteratorCheck(qIter, execCxt) ;
}
private static void dump(ExecutionContext execContext, boolean includeAll)
{
if ( includeAll )
{
Iterator<QueryIterator> iterAll = execContext.listAllIterators() ;
if ( iterAll != null )
while(iterAll.hasNext())
{
QueryIterator qIter = iterAll.next() ;
warn(qIter, "Iterator: ") ;
}
}
Iterator<QueryIterator> iterOpen = execContext.listOpenIterators() ;
while(iterOpen.hasNext())
{
QueryIterator qIterOpen = iterOpen.next() ;
warn(qIterOpen, "Open iterator: ") ;
iterOpen.remove() ;
}
}
private static void warn(QueryIterator qIter, String str)
{
str = str + Lib.className(qIter) ;
if ( qIter instanceof QueryIteratorBase )
{
QueryIteratorBase qIterBase = (QueryIteratorBase)qIter ;
{
QueryIter qIterLN = (QueryIter)qIter ;
str = str+"/"+qIterLN.getIteratorNumber() ;
}
String x = qIterBase.debug() ;
if ( x.length() > 0 )
str = str+" : "+x ;
}
Log.warn(QueryIteratorCheck.class, str) ;
}
}
